Mastering DIY: Essential Baumarkt Werkzeuge for Beginners
Every beginner in the world of DIY projects knows the importance of having the right tools in their arsenal. DIY, or Do-It-Yourself, is not only a great way to save money but also an opportunity to unleash your creativity and learn new skills. Whether you want to fix something around the house or embark on a larger project, having the essential tools from a Baumarkt (German for hardware store) is crucial. In this article, we will explore some of the must-have tools every beginner should consider to master their DIY endeavors.
1. Claw Hammer: This is one of the most basic but essential tools in any DIY toolkit. Whether you want to hang a picture frame or build a simple wooden shelf, a claw hammer will come in handy. Its dual-purpose head allows you to drive nails into surfaces using the flat side and remove them using the curved claws.
2. Screwdriver Set: A set of screwdrivers with different head sizes and types is a must for any DIY project. Whether you need to tighten loose screws on furniture or assemble shelves, having the right screwdriver can save you a lot of time and effort. Look for a set that includes both flathead and Phillips-head screwdrivers to cover all your bases.
3. Hand Saw: Another essential tool for beginners is a hand saw. Whether it’s cutting wood for a small project or trimming branches in the garden, a hand saw is versatile and easy to use. Opt for a general-purpose saw with a reasonably fine-toothed blade for smoother cuts.
4. Tape Measure: Precision is key in DIY projects, and a tape measure is a vital tool for accurate measurements. From measuring a piece of wood for a shelf to ensuring a picture is hung straight on the wall, a tape measure will be your best friend. Look for one that offers both metric and imperial measurements for versatility.
5. Adjustable Wrench: An adjustable wrench, also known as a spanner, is necessary for tightening or loosening different sizes of nuts and bolts. Whether it’s assembling furniture or fixing a leaking pipe, an adjustable wrench will save you from frustration and make the task much easier.
6. Utility Knife: A utility knife is an incredibly versatile tool that you can use for a variety of tasks. From cutting through boxes to opening packages or trimming materials, a sharp utility knife is a must-have in any DIY toolkit. Make sure to handle it with caution as it is extremely sharp.
7. Level: To ensure everything you hang or build is perfectly straight, a level is indispensable. Hanging pictures, installing shelves, or even building a backyard deck, a level ensures that your work is precise and visually appealing.
8. Pliers: Pliers, with their strong grip and multi-purpose functionality, are an essential tool. They come in handy when you need to cut wires, hold objects firmly, or even bend and shape materials. Look for a set that includes both needle-nose pliers and slip-joint pliers for added versatility.
9. Cordless Drill: While not necessarily an essential tool for beginners, a cordless drill can greatly expand your DIY capabilities. It allows you to drill holes and drive screws quickly and efficiently, making it a worthwhile investment as you progress in your DIY journey.
10. Safety Gear: Last but certainly not least, investing in safety gear is crucial for every DIY enthusiast. Gloves, safety glasses, and ear protection should be worn, especially when operating power tools or working with hazardous materials.
